Quick Facts — Settlement Agreement Lawyers

A debt settlement attorney is a type of attorney who specializes in negotiating with lenders to reduce the amount owed by clients. Moreover, they have extensive familiarity with bargaining with creditors and have the skills needed to get their customers the best deals possible.

Job Description of a Debt Settlement Attorney

Debt settlement attorneys are important in helping individuals and companies manage their debts and avoid bankruptcy. Below are some of the major roles and duties of a debt settlement attorney.

  • Negotiating with Creditors: The primary function of a debt settlement advocate is to negotiate on behalf of their client with creditors, during which he discusses the clients' financial position, explains why they cannot meet their obligations as per the agreement, and comes up with a proposal for settlement. They aim to persuade the creditor that accepting smaller amounts or a longer repayment period would be mutually beneficial.
  • Clarifying Debt Settlement Alternatives: Debt management lawyers perform an essential duty as regards explaining what debt negotiation choices are available for their clients plus laying down pros and cons for each option so that customers can select wisely. They also educate consumers on the potential dangers involved in using professional help from these firms while avoiding scams disguised as relief programs.
  • Evaluating Financial Documents: Understanding their client’s financial status properly is important for debt resolution lawyers. All this information will be used by them when analyzing given papers such as bank statements, credit reports, tax returns, etc., thus evaluating your indebtedness correctly. This becomes handy when developing a personal program aimed at meeting customer’s demands.
  • Making up Proposal On Repayment Schedule: After going through these sheets containing financial information about your company and a description of our alternatives in terms of resolving your liability, we are going to make out a plan that covers reduced payment amounts plus the duration required for refunding it. And those developments passed onto the lender finally result in reaching a mutually profitable agreement.
  • Providing Legal Representation: During this process of settling outstanding balances, advocates may act as the client’s direct link to creditors, review and negotiate settlement offers, and ensure that terms are legally binding. Sometimes, they may have to go before a magistrate on behalf of clients.
  • Reviewing Debt Settlement Agreements: The attorney will monitor the debt relief agreement to confirm that the debtor honors their obligations, like timely payments, and also ensure that the lender is keeping its end of the deal. If any problem arises, they will be settled without much delay by these attorneys.

Advantages of Hiring a Debt Settlement Attorney

Debt settlement is the process of negotiation with creditors to reduce the total amount owed, which can be very difficult. While individuals can undertake this procedure on their own, involving a debt settlement attorney has many benefits that make it faster and more effective. Here are some notable advantages:

  • Debt Settlement Expertise and Experience: Over time, these lawyers have dealt with numerous clients seeking relief from debts; hence, they can handle any situation during negotiations over outstanding balances. They know how cases move within courts or administrative agencies and thus can enable people to achieve optimum outcomes in their legal matters. Besides, a good understanding of credit laws, creditors’ rights as well as methods utilized during bargaining makes communication easier between them and lending institutions.
  • Protection against Harassment: Lawyers specializing in debt settlements contribute as a shield against creditor harassment. This involves contacting creditors so that they may not call or write too frequently while collecting money owed by someone else. Moreover, such legal practitioners could sue for violating the Fair Debt Collection Practices Act (FDCPA) for damages, among other sanctions.
  • Enhanced Negotiation Skills: These professionals negotiate on behalf of those who hire them for representation during talks with lenders about settling what one owes. In doing so, they employ their skills plus past successes to secure a favorable agreement from the client's perspective; additionally, it saves them from making common errors like accepting an unfair deal or unaffordable one.
  • Better Legal Representation: A person going through debt settlement may need the services of a debt settlement attorney who can offer legal representation throughout this process. This does away with any possibility of errors or omissions while protecting legal rights. When sued or facing wage garnishment, one can rely on his/her counsel for representation before the court leading to desirable results.
  • Customized Debt Settlement Plan: Personalized strategies for settling debts are crucial when dealing with debt settlement attorneys. By examining these individuals' liabilities, salaries, and expenses, lawyers could propose potential solutions that appear suitable at that time. In addition, they may provide instructions on how to manage finances better to prevent future borrowing.
  • Faster Debt Settlement: An individual may be able to settle their debts faster than if they chose not to use a lawyer specializing in this area of law practice after all. The latter will use negotiation skills and knowledge to obtain quicker settlements under more favorable conditions while avoiding delays and other complications associated with it.
  • Lower Debt Settlement Amounts: One benefit of hiring an attorney who specializes in settling debts is that such an attorney can help negotiate lower settlement amounts than would otherwise have been possible without such assistance. Importance of Debt Settlement Agreements

It is an arrangement in which the lender and borrower negotiate to settle a debt for less than what is owed. It is done when the person owing cannot pay back the entire amount of money they owe these lending institutions.

Specific terms may differ, but many of these agreements involve borrowers making one single payment to lenders and being released from their debts. If you opt for this method of debt settlement, it will lower your credit score since you might default on the loan agreement.

When a borrower cannot fully repay their debts, a debt settlement agreement can be a means for them to work with their lender to come to a mutually beneficial agreement, which may result in the borrower paying less than the full amount owed.

This will help reduce his overall liabilities and make it possible for them to get back on track financially. On top of this, it saves time and money as compared to other alternatives, such as suing borrowers through legal channels that are often protracted. Therefore, both parties should view this type of contract as beneficial because it provides them with an opportunity to deal with outstanding obligations arising from loans taken out earlier.
